Default bad plugs?

car has been acting slow and sluggish lately, if i go WOT it stumbles its way troughout the RPM range, doesnt have the smooth powerband it used to.

It doesnt always do that, but last night in 3rd gear it barely would go over 4500 rpm's @ WOT.SES light came on.

Its also running rich and backfires alot. SES light came on last night, checked the codes p0157 and p0137. these are the rear 02', but rear 02 wont cause this right?
Could it be plugs/wires or should i just take it to a shop and have them figure it out?

First thing you need to do is change the plugs and wires and clean the MAF sensor. If the car runs like new again, you've solved the problem.

The MAf sensor is located on the intake tube, between the intake lid and the throttle body. Its a black plastic housing with 2 wiring harnesses coming off of it. Unplug the harnesses, remove it from the intake, and clean it with CRC Mas Air Flow Cleaner spray. Do not use anything else besides that spray to clean it, other cleaners/chemicals will damage the element.

If its still acting up, after doing all of that, your cats are probably plugged up. GM had a recall on the cats of certain year LS1 F-Bodys, check with your dealer to see if your is involved in the recall. If its not covered under warranty, unbolt the catalytic converters from the manifolds, start the car, and take ir for a quick drive. If it runs normally (just loud), you've found the problem.

Goo luck.
